Job description

Description

The EMIC Creative Content Creator is responsible for producing engaging, high-quality content that reflects the heart, mission, and voice of EMIC across all social media platforms. This role works closely with the Social Media Manager and Communications Team to create visual and written content that inspires, informs, and connects with the EMIC community and global audience.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Create, edit, and publish high-quality video, photo, and graphic content for platforms including Instagram, Facebook, TikTok, YouTube, and X (Twitter).
  • Develop creative concepts and ideas for weekly posts, stories, and campaigns that align with EMIC’s vision and current sermon series or ministry initiatives.
  • Capture content during services, events, and behind-the-scenes moments that highlight the life and culture of EMIC.
  • Collaborate with ministry teams to promote events, initiatives, and testimonies through digital storytelling.
  • Write engaging captions, short-form copy, and hashtags optimized for platform engagement.
  • Stay current on social media trends, algorithms, and best practices to ensure EMIC remains relevant and innovative.
  • Assist with social media analytics and performance tracking to help guide future strategies.
  • Maintain brand consistency in tone, visual style, and message across all content.
  • Responsible for facilitating the creative process across multiple demographics of Student Ministries.
  • Responsible for the integration of creative elements from other EMIC areas within Student Ministries demographics.
  • Makes scheduled assessments of the creative output of all demographics within Student Ministries and makes suggestions of how to improve creative and production quality based on assessments.
  • Facilitate the creative process for Student Ministries broadcasts and productions.
  • Edits and animates creative elements for social media and use as service elements.
  • Develops new concepts and fresh segments for social media, service elements or for use during special events.
  • Responsible for archiving all creative content from all departments of EMIC.
  • Mentors students/volunteers in the creative process, cultivating their creative gifts and talents.
  • Participates in Sunday/Wednesday services for areas as directed.
  • Performs other duties as assigned
